Chunky Pandey passed the driving test after 43 years, celebrated the achievement on Instagram
Chunky Pandey has shared an important achievement of his life on Instagram. The actor told that he has passed the driving test after 43 years.

Chunky Panday shared a picture on Instagram on Tuesday, September 10, in which he revealed that he has finally passed his driving test after 43 years. He also thanked the Regional Transport Office (RTO) of Mumbai.
He captioned the post, “Took my driving test again after 43 years. And guess what, I passed. Thanks to RTO Mumbai.” In the photo, Chunky Panday can be seen sitting inside a car, holding the steering wheel and flashing a million dollar smile. An RTO officer is sitting next to him.
Reacting to the post, actress Sonam Khan wrote, “Congratulations! You don’t know how to drive?? If so, thankfully I didn’t have any driving scenes with you. Anyway, congratulations once again.” They have worked together in the 1989 film Mitti Aur Sona.
Meanwhile, actor Sikandar Kher wrote, “Shaandaar”.

Last month, Chunky Panday had opened up about the dark phase of his life before he became famous. The actor revealed that he used to work as a part-time car dealer at that time. “It wasn’t easy, but it was fun. Well, those were my struggling days. I was a part-time hustler and part-time car dealer, so I got to drive those cars. Every day, I would be in a different car, going around producers’ offices,” he revealed. IANS,
Talking about work, Chunky Pandey was last seen in director Puri Jagannath’s Liger (2022), starring his daughter Ananya Pandey and actor Vijay Deverakonda in the lead roles. He was also a part of the Amazon miniTV series Industry.
